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02 835162376 4658701881 387177
9222945 863 0246336365
9222945 863 0246336365
9220038533 13399 5816 6091374402
All about undefined
Interested in learning more?
9222945 863 0246336365
9220038533 13399 5816 6091374402
See more
121540 6515 423037118
00591989 044016200 12
See more
3886499444 5954137 34
5961767887 38632 25 360024
See more